What are the causes for schizophrenia?
What are the causes
Most researchers believe that both biology and the environment play a role in schizophrenia.
Biological: Brain chemical imbalances may contribute to schizophrenia. In addition, a person may be more likely to develop schizophrenia if someone in the family has it too.
Environmental: Certain experiences in life, and stress, can trigger the condition, such as stress due to work- or school-related matters
